Description

26.0.0.6: https://github.com/OpenLiberty/open-liberty-s2i/releases/tag/26.0.0.6 is openliberty's last release version, yet the automation has bumped it to 26.0.0.7. We imported this in samples and it is causing installation failures in OKD. Could we fix the automation so that it checks if the version exists before bumping it?
